QuickBooks is an indispensable tool for small businesses and accountants alike. However, it can be frustrating when you encounter unexpected errors that prevent you from accessing your account or using the software. One of the most common issues users face is being kicked out of QuickBooks. This can be caused by a variety of factors, from incorrect login credentials to software glitches. In this comprehensive guide, we will delve into the reasons why QuickBooks may be kicking you out and provide step-by-step solutions to resolve the problem.

Incorrect Login Credentials

The most common reason for being kicked out of QuickBooks is incorrect login credentials. Ensure that you are entering your username and password correctly. If you have forgotten your password, you can reset it by clicking on the “Forgot Password” link on the QuickBooks login page.

Software Glitches

Sometimes, QuickBooks may experience software glitches that can cause you to be kicked out of the program. These glitches can be caused by a variety of factors, such as corrupted files or outdated software. To resolve this issue, try restarting QuickBooks or updating the software to the latest version.

Antivirus or Firewall Interference

Your antivirus or firewall software may be blocking QuickBooks from accessing the internet or running certain functions. Disable your antivirus or firewall software temporarily and try accessing QuickBooks again. If this resolves the issue, you may need to configure your antivirus or firewall settings to allow QuickBooks to access the internet.

Outdated Operating System

An outdated operating system can also cause QuickBooks to kick you out. Ensure that your operating system is up-to-date by checking for updates in the Windows Update or macOS System Preferences.

Corrupted Data Files

Corrupted data files can lead to a variety of problems in QuickBooks, including being kicked out of the program. To resolve this issue, you may need to restore your QuickBooks data from a backup.

Network Connectivity Issues

If you are using QuickBooks Online, network connectivity issues may cause you to be kicked out of the program. Ensure that your internet connection is stable and that you are not experiencing any network outages.

Other Causes

In some cases, QuickBooks may kick you out due to other factors, such as:

  • Using an unsupported version of QuickBooks
  • Running QuickBooks on an incompatible computer
  • Having too many users accessing QuickBooks simultaneously

Questions We Hear a Lot

Q: Why do I keep getting kicked out of QuickBooks after entering my correct login credentials?
A: This may be due to software glitches or corrupted data files. Try restarting QuickBooks or restoring your data from a backup.

Q: My antivirus software is blocking QuickBooks. How do I configure the settings to allow access?
A: Refer to your antivirus software‘s documentation for instructions on how to create an exception for QuickBooks.

Q: How can I prevent being kicked out of QuickBooks due to network connectivity issues?
A: Ensure that your internet connection is stable and that you are not experiencing any network outages. You may also want to consider using a wired connection instead of Wi-Fi.
